Taxonomic Classification

Rank Grevy's zebra Tropical Pine
Kingdom Animalia (Animals) Plantae (Plants)
Phylum Chordata (Chordates) Coniferophyta (Conifers)
Class Mammalia (Mammals) Pinopsida (Conifers)
Order Perissodactyla (Odd-toed Ungulates) Pinales (Pines & Allies)
Family Equidae (Horses & Zebras) Pinaceae (Pine Family)
Genus Equus (Horses & Zebras) Pinus (Pines)
Species Equus grevyi Pinus tropicalis

Tropical Pine

Habitat

Found across multiple habitat types including tropical and subtropical moist broadleaf forests, tropical and subtropical dry broadleaf forests, and tropical and subtropical coniferous forests, among 5 distinct biome types within the Neotropic biogeographic realm.

Range

Found in Cuba. Currently classified as Vulnerable on the IUCN Red List, this species faces significant conservation challenges across its range.
